Mission
Tantoryn AI exists to build automated crypto-futures trading intelligence that is honest about what it knows and does not yet know — structured enough to be tested, and disciplined enough that a claim is never made ahead of its evidence.
Why Tantoryn Exists
Most public trading-signal products optimize for the appearance of confidence. Tantoryn AI takes the opposite approach: build the decision pipeline first, prove each stage independently, and only then talk about what it can do. The project would rather publish a negative result than an unearned claim.
Engineering & Research Philosophy
Material changes — a new candidate rule, a new model, a new risk parameter — follow the same discipline: research under frozen, leakage-safe rules, and formal approval before anything is promoted toward higher trust. Independent verification is standard practice: most material results go through review by someone who did not build them before that approval is given, with a limited set of scope-based exceptions closed only through a separate formal governance decision. Approval is deliberately separated from execution, so no single step can mark its own work as finished.

Current Stage
The project is in Early Public Beta. The full pipeline runs against live markets end to end, but strictly in virtual/live-paper mode; real-money order execution is disabled. The current work is proving evaluator quality and system reliability with evidence.
Long-Term Objective
The long-term objective is a validated system that can be trusted with real market decisions because its evidence says so — not because it claims so. Any move toward controlled real-risk operation will follow, not precede, that evidence.
What We Optimize For
Three trade-offs we make deliberately, every time they come up.
Evidence over claims
A result is public only once it has climbed the evidence ladder — hypothesis, backtest, leakage-safe validation, independent audit, final approval. Until then, it is research, described as research.
Risk control over confidence
The risk and lifecycle engine is independent of ML by design and cannot be overridden by a confident model score. A good prediction is never sufficient on its own.
